6th Prize
Bang & Olufsen A4 Wide CD Rack - Aluminium
You cannot buy these any more, and rarely do they come up on the used market.. So, what if we told you we had a NOS (new, old stock) A4 Wave CD Rack. This is the even rarer 'A4 Large' version, made from a single piece of Aluminium and a capacity to hold up to 24 CD's - although you can hold whatever you like on it! Even empty, the A4 CD rack is a work of art and is highly prized by Bang & Olufsen collectors worldwide. Boxed, unused and as fresh as the day it left Struer almost 10 years ago.. A surefire appreciating asset to keep and cherish. Only BeoWorld offers Prizes like this..

5th Prize
A Vintage Bang & Olufsen BeoMaster 1000
Awarded the 1966 iF Prize for Industrial Design, the BeoMaster 1000 became an instant classic. Although produced in large numbers, excellent examples are becoming increasingly hard to find. However, BeoWorld has once again found you a 'one owner' example that was bought new in 1970, used until the mid 70's, then packed away in storage for another 25 or so years by its elderly owner. This is a really special example of a very special piece of B&O, with its advanced features and beautiful 'piano key' selectors. A real piece for the collectors amongst us, and something to treasure for the rookie B&O collector!
